This is a release from "Rare Malts"—a great Diageo line that features rare bottles hailing from distilleries that are typically only found in blends. When these bottles are launched as a stand-alone single malt, watch out. They're a force to be reckoned with.
One of the key ingredients of Johnnie Walker blends, Teaninich fits that profile. But don't judge it for that. This great malt from 1972 is bottled at cask strength and delivers robust spice, a smokey kick and is known for its grassy and oily core. This drop is rare and is not to be missed.
This is a one-of-a-kind, under-the-radar malt that's a favorite with hardcore maltheads.
